Summary
Appeal from the Iowa District Court for Polk County, Jeanie K. Vaudt, Judge. AFFIRMED. Considered by Bower, C.J., Mullins, J., and Danilson, S.J. Opinion by Danilson, S.J. (8 pages)
Fred Moore appeals the district court order denying his request for postconviction relief from his conviction of first-degree murder. OPINION HOLDS: We determine the district court did not err by finding Moore did not show he was entitled to relief on the basis of newly-discovered evidence. We also find no error in the district court’s conclusion Moore did not meet the standard necessary to prove his claim of actual innocence. We affirm the district court’s decision denying Moore’s application for postconviction relief.
